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
790938524 87184198 40 5649446197 05
1025196350 322967122 63232666
1025196350 322967122 63232666
79 34 821 33191
All about undefined
Interested in learning more?
1025196350 322967122 63232666
79 34 821 33191
See more
67608503 31176
056759 43 5210 954123878
See more
046175 028088499 178
22 66 6467909
See more